Leviton is a well-known manufacturer of electrical devices and components, including dimmer switches. Leviton dimmer switches are highly regarded for their quality and functionality in the field of electrical and home improvement. Here are some key points about Leviton dimmer switches:

  1. Variety of Dimmer Switches: Leviton offers a wide range of dimmer switches to meet various lighting control needs. These include single-pole dimmers, three-way dimmers, and dimmers with advanced features.

  2. Compatibility: Leviton dimmer switches are designed to be compatible with various types of lighting, including incandescent, LED, CFL, halogen, and other bulb types. This ensures that you can use them with different fixtures and lamps.

  3. Smooth Dimming: Leviton dimmers are known for providing smooth and flicker-free dimming, allowing you to adjust the light level to your preference. This feature is essential for creating the right ambiance in a room.

  4. LED Indicator Lights: Many Leviton dimmer switches come with LED indicator lights to help locate the switch in the dark. The LED can also serve as a locator light when the switch is off.

  5. Easy Installation: Leviton dimmers are designed for easy installation and typically fit into standard electrical boxes. They come with clear instructions to help DIY enthusiasts or professionals set them up quickly.

  6. Presets and Programming: Some Leviton dimmer switches offer preset lighting levels and programmable options. This allows you to set and recall your preferred lighting levels easily.

  7. Multi-Location Dimming: Leviton offers three-way and multi-location dimming options, enabling you to control the same lighting circuit from multiple switches in different parts of a room or hallway.

  8. Smart Dimmers: Leviton also offers smart dimmer switches that can be integrated with home automation systems.These smart dimmers often allow remote control via a smartphone app, voice commands through virtual assistants, and scheduling features for energy efficiency.

  9. Durability and Quality: Leviton is known for its commitment to producing durable and reliable electrical products. Their dimmer switches are built to last and withstand everyday use.

  10. Safety: Leviton dimmers adhere to safety standards and are designed to prevent overheating and overloading, ensuring the safety of your electrical system.

In summary, Leviton dimmer switches are trusted products known for their versatility, compatibility with various lighting types, and smooth dimming capabilities. They cater to a range of preferences, from basic dimmers to advanced smart dimming solutions, making them a popular choice for homeowners and professionals in the electrical and home improvement industry.

Question: What size bulb can be used with this dimmer? There seem to be all kinds of size bulbs available
Answer: That's right in the description: 150 watts LED / CFL, 600 watts incandescent. Just add the power requirements of all the bulbs controlled by the dimmer. For example, I'm using it to control 4 60 watt incandescent bulbs, total 240 watts. For LEDs / CFLs, use the actual power required, not the "equivalency". So a 23-watt CFL that says it's as bright as a 100 watt incandescent still only counts as 23 watts.

LED drivers are rated fora maximum load (measured in volts, amps and/or watts) that must not be exceeded.The number of lamps that can be installed on a single-phase control dimmer may seem to be an easy calculation.For example, suppose you want to know how many 15W LED fixtures can be installed on a 600W dimmer. Youmight divide the 600W by 15W and determine that you could control 40 fixtures. Unfortunately, that result mightbe wrong. In fact, you may only be able to use 6 LED fixtures on a dimmer rated for 600W.Even though the LED fixture may draw only 15W continuously, there may be a start-up in-rush current or arepetitive half cycle surge that makes the dimmer think that the current is much higher. That 15W LED fixturemay appear to the dimmer as a 100W incandescent load. If that happens and you are using more than 6 LEDfixtures, you will overload the dimmer.The average start-up or half-cycle stress that has been observed is the equivalent of a 100W incandescent lamp,even for LED loads of less than 20W! * For 10W & 15W Liton -DLV products, consult the charts in the LED Dimming Facts Guide to reference tested maximums by dimmer. * Remove the dimmer from the line to see if the problem is solved. * Change dimmer to one with a higher maximum load. * Split the circuit into multiple loads.Possible Cause #5: Dimmer UnderloadSome dimmers may not perform well if too little load is put on them. A minimum number of fixtures may berequired to operate correctly due to the 25W - 40W minimum load that most incandescent dimmers require tooperate correctly under all conditions. When using incandescent bulbs, the minimum load requirement waseasily met. However, with LED four or more loads may be required for a dimmer to reach the required minimumload. * For 10W & 15W Liton - DLV products, consult the charts in the LED Dimming Facts Guide to reference tested minimum by dimmer. * Remove the dimmer from the line to see if the problem is solved. * Change dimmer to one with a lower minimum load.

Question: The max brightness seems lower than when I had a non-digital dimmer. How do I adjust? I see instructions for the lower dim range but not the max
Answer: Please see Lutron's Application Note #459. All of these settings are NOT listed in the manual that came with your switch. www.lutron.com/TechnicalDocumentLibrary/048459.pdf You want to adjust IL7, the high-end trim.IL1: Preset Light Level (last setting or set permanently)IL2: Fade ON Time (0.75 to 15.0 seconds)IL3: Fade OFF Time (0.75 to 15.0 seconds)IL4: Delayed Fade to OFF (time to leave the room - 10 to 70 seconds)IL5: Enable/Disable Indicator Lights (LED dots off or on)IL6: Low-End Trim (minimum brightness)IL7: High-End Trim (maximum brightness)
Question: how much power do led indicator lights draw
Answer: Approximately 0.02 Watts (2 cents per year at $0.10/kWh) if they did the job right of designing it (switching converter,) and 0.25 Watts (20 cents per year at $0.10/kWh) if they took the lazy way out (simple resistor.)

Troubleshooting

Symptom:

- Bulbs turn off while being dimmed.

- Bulbs turn on at high light level but do not turn on at a low light level, or take too long to turn on at low end.

- Bulbs flicker or flash when dimmed do a low light level.

- Bulbs or dimmers are buzzing.

Solution:

1. Verify all bulbs are marked dimmable.

2. Remove wallplate and locate sensitivity dial.

3. Turn up (counter-clockwise) sensitivity dial slowly until symptom is no longer present.
